•Do not apply shock or vibration to this
camcorder. This may cause a malfunction.
If you must use this camcorder where
shock or vibration is likely, use a
commercially available shock absorber,
etc.
•Do not do any of the following when the
(Movie)/ (Still) mode lamps
(p.12) or the access lamp (p. 14) is lit or
flashing.
Otherwise, the media may be damaged,
recorded images may be lost or other
malfunctions could occur.
–Eject the “Memory Stick PRO Duo”
media from the camcorder
–Remove the battery pack or AC Adaptor
from the camcorder.
–Apply mechanical shock or vibration to
the camcorder.
•When connecting your camcorder to
another device with a cable, be sure to
insert the connector plug in the correct
way. Pushing the plug forcibly into the
terminal will damage the terminal and
may result in a malfunction of your
camcorder.
About menu items, LCD panel and lens
•A menu i tem that is grayed out is not
available under the current recording or
playback conditions.
•The LC D screen is manufactured using
extremely high-precision technology, so
over 99.99% of the pixels are operational
for effective use. However, there may be
some tiny black points and/or bright
points (white, red, blue, or green in color)
that appear constantly on the LCD screen.
These points are normal results of the
manufacturing process and do not affect
the recording in any way.
•E xposing the LCD screen or the lens to
direct sunlight for long periods of time
may cause malfunctions.
•D o not aim at the sun. Doing so might
cause your camcorder to malfunction.
Take images of the sun only in low light
conditions, such as at dusk.

On recording
•Whe n you use a memory card with your
camcorder for the first time, formatting
the memory card with your camcorder
(p.45) is recomme nded for stable
operation.
All data recorded on the memory card will
be deleted when it is formatted, and
cannot be recovered. Save important data
to your computer, etc., beforehand.
•B efore starting to record, test the
recording function to make sure the image
and sound are recorded without any
problems.
